Public infrastructure lit at night

Public work is not technically different from commercial work. It is administratively different — procurement rules, prevailing wage, documentation standards and public accountability shape how the job runs far more than the electrical scope does. Contractors who treat it as ordinary commercial work tend to struggle with the paperwork rather than the wiring.

Public procurement runs on documentation

The electrical work on a municipal project is rarely the hard part. The administration is: bid compliance, prevailing wage determination, certified payroll, documented change control, and a closeout package that will survive public records scrutiny years later.

Contractors who treat this as an afterthought create problems for the agency that hired them. We run it properly from the start.

Efficiency funding public agencies leave unclaimed

Public facilities frequently qualify for utility incentive programmes, state efficiency funding and performance contracting structures that go unused because nobody has the time to navigate them. Municipal buildings tend to have high operating hours and old equipment, which is precisely the profile that produces strong returns.

Performance contracting is particularly well suited to public agencies, because it funds the work from verified savings rather than from a capital budget that has to compete with everything else. See performance contracting.

Street and area lighting

Municipal street and area lighting is a large, continuous energy load and a visible public service. Conversion programmes deliver both a substantial energy reduction and a maintenance reduction, but they draw public attention in a way that a warehouse retrofit does not.

Colour temperature is the decision that generates public comment. Cooler sources measure well and consistently draw complaints about harshness and light trespass into homes; warmer sources are generally better received. It is worth deciding deliberately rather than accepting whatever the fixture supplier quotes.
